Art split apart Allie's right hand down below the wrist, but her hand and wrist are clearly intact when she is attempting to crawl to her phone.
Art clearly removes sections of skin off of Allie's back but when she is crawling on the floor, there's only blood smeared across her back with no skin missing.
The morning after the fire, Sienna's hair is nicely straight. When she's at school it's wavy like natural texture. Then at the shop later in the same day it's back to straight.
When Art attacks Brooke, he breaks her knee; but later, when he knees on her, both knees can be seen intact.
When Art kills Barbara, he shoots her head off her body. Shortly afterwards, he sets Barbara off at the table and it's clear that her head is still attached to her body (e.g. when Art stuffs food into her open head).
Art's favorite acid is fluoroantimonic acid he has in a clear glass bottle. It is a superacid capable of dissolving even glass.
The events of the first Terrifier movie are referred to as Miles County Massacre. This is a fictitious county, but the cops who arrived at the the carnage site wore NYPD insignia. However, the location is not explicitly mentioned in the first Terrifier movie.
When Jonathan is reading about Art on a web page, a paragraph begins with 'Without further adieu".
As the actor playing the Truant Officer starts to turn to leave after talking to Sienna's mother he looks at the camera.
The morning after her dream, as Sienna is drinking her coffee, a little gets spit out and she does a quick check to see where it went.
The Little Pale Girl is shown watching a live broadcast of a local news program on a small analog television with an antenna. The transition to digital broadcast for all U.S. television went into effect 14 years earlier in 2009. Therefore, it would not be possible for the analog television to pick up a live broadcasting signal without a digital box.

During the news report on the Miles County massacre, it is mentioned that the body of Art the Clown disappeared but no mention is made of the murder and mutilation of the doctor in the morgue. It's not clear what the police ever did about the latter murder and its connection to the disappearance of Art's body.
